Kā nomainīt datora IP adresi no komandrindas
Ir pietiekami viegli mainīt IP adresi savā datorā, izmantojot vadības paneli, bet vai jūs zinājāt, ka varat to darīt arī no komandrindas?
IP adreses maiņa ar vadības paneļa saskarni nav sarežģīta, taču tai ir nepieciešams noklikšķināt, izmantojot vairākus dažādus logus un dialoglodziņus. Ja jūs esat komandu uzvednes līdzjutējs, jūs varat to izdarīt ātrāk, izmantojot netsh
komanda, kas ir tikai viens no lielākajiem tīkla komunālajiem pakalpojumiem, kas iebūvēti sistēmā Windows.
The netsh
komanda ļauj konfigurēt gandrīz jebkuru tīkla savienojumu aspektu sistēmā Windows. Lai to paveiktu, jums būs jāatver komandu uzvedne ar administratīvām privilēģijām. Operētājsistēmā Windows 10 vai 8.1 ar peles labo pogu noklikšķiniet uz izvēlnes Sākt (vai nospiediet tastatūras taustiņu Windows + X) un izvēlieties “Command Prompt (Admin)”. rezultātu un izvēlieties “Run as Administrator”.
Skatiet tīkla informāciju
Pirms maināt savu IP adresi un saistīto informāciju, vajadzēs atrast visu tīkla nosaukumu, kuru vēlaties mainīt. Lai to izdarītu, ierakstiet šādu komandu:
netsh interfeiss ipv4 show config
Ritiniet uz leju, līdz redzat saskarni, kuru meklējat. Mūsu piemērā mēs modificēsim Wi-Fi interfeisu, kas mūsu mašīnā ir tikai nosaukts “Wi-Fi”. Jūs redzēsiet arī citus noklusējuma nosaukumus, kurus Windows piešķir saskarnēm, piemēram, “Local Area Connection, ““ Local Area Connection * 2 ”un“ Ethernet ”. Atrodiet to, ko meklējat, un atzīmējiet precīzu nosaukumu. Varat arī kopēt un ielīmēt nosaukumu pie Notepad un vēlāk atgriezties komandu uzvednē, lai atvieglotu lietas.
Mainiet IP adresi, apakštīkla maska un noklusējuma vārteju
Izmantojot saskarnes nosaukumu, jūs esat gatavs mainīt IP adresi, apakštīkla masku un vārteju. Lai to izdarītu, jums tiks izsniegta komanda, izmantojot šādu sintaksi:
netsh interfeiss ipv4 iestatīt adreses nosaukumu = "JŪSU INTERFACE NAME" statisks IP_ADDRESS SUBNET_MASK GATEWAY
Tātad, piemēram, jūsu komanda var izskatīties šādi:
netsh interfeiss ipv4 komplekts adrešu nosaukums = statiskais statuss "Wi-Fi" 192.168.3.8 255.255.255.0 192.168.3.1
kur informācija tiek aizstāta ar visu, ko vēlaties izmantot. Mūsu piemērā komanda veic šādas darbības:
- Izmanto interfeisa nosaukumu “Wi-Fi”
- Iestata IP adresi uz 192.168.3.1
- Iestata apakštīkla masku uz 255.255.255.0
- Iestata noklusējuma vārteju uz 192.168.3.1
Un, ja izmantojat statisku IP adresi, bet vēlaties pārslēgties uz DHCP servera automātiski piešķirtu IP adresi, piemēram, maršrutētāju, varat izmantot šādu komandu:
netsh interfeiss ipv4 set address name = “JŪSU INTERFACE NAME” avots = dhcp
Mainiet DNS iestatījumus
Varat arī izmantot netsh
komandu, lai mainītu tīkla interfeisa lietotos DNS serverus. Trešās puses DNS serveri, piemēram, Google publiskais DNS un OpenDNS, var būt ātrāki un uzticamāki nekā jūsu ISP nodrošinātie DNS serveri. Lai kāds būtu jūsu DNS servera maiņas iemesls, to var izdarīt arī maršrutētājam, lai tas ietekmētu visas ierīces, kas saņem informāciju no maršrutētāja vai atsevišķas ierīces. Ja vēlaties mainīt DNS serverus tikai vienam datoram, tas ir viegli izdarāms ar netsh
komandu.
Jums būs jāizmanto šī komanda divas reizes: vienreiz, lai iestatītu primāro DNS serveri un vienreiz iestatītu DNS sekundāro vai rezerves serveri. Lai iestatītu primāro DNS serveri, izmantojiet šādu sintaksi:
netsh interfeiss ipv4 set dns name = "JŪSU INTERFACE NAME" statisks DNS_SERVER
Tā, piemēram, jūsu komanda var izskatīties līdzīgi tālāk norādītajam (kurā mēs to iestatījām Google primārajam publiskajam DNS serverim, 8.8.8.8.):
netsh interfeiss ipv4 komplekts dns name = "Wi-Fi" statiskais 8.8.8.8
Lai iestatītu sekundāro DNS serveri, izmantosiet ļoti līdzīgu komandu:
netsh interfeiss ipv4 komplekts dns name = "JŪSU INTERFACE NAME" statiskais DNS_SERVER indekss = 2
Tātad, turpinot mūsu piemēru, jūs varat iestatīt sekundāro DNS kā Google publiskā DNS sekundāro serveri, kas ir 8.8.4.4.
netsh interfeiss ipv4 komplekts dns name = "Wi-Fi" statiskais 8.8.4.4 indekss = 2
Un tāpat kā ar IP adresi, varat to mainīt arī tā, lai tīkla interfeiss automātiski noņemtu DNS iestatījumus no DHCP servera. Vienkārši izmantojiet šādu komandu:
netsh interfeiss ipv4 set dnsservers nosaukums "YOUR INTERFACE NAME" avots = dhcp
Un tur jums tas ir. Vai jums patīk rakstīt komandu uzvednē vai vienkārši vēlaties ieskaidrot savus kolēģus, tagad jūs zināt visu komandrindas burvību, kas nepieciešama, lai mainītu jūsu IP adreses iestatījumus.